Chicago’s Timber Hill Group adds CFO, managing director of acquisitions

Sofia Michis and Dave Tombers have joined Timber Hill Group, a Chicago-based private equity real estate firm specializing in the acquisition, development, and management of industrial outdoor storage (IOS) assets throughout the U.S., as Chief Financial Officer and Managing Director of Acquisitions respectively. Both will also serve on the firm’s executive leadership team.

Michis was most recently the Chief Financial Officer at New Jersey-based Sitex Group where she supported the firm as it expanded its platform and footprint across the Northeast industrial corridor. In her role, she oversaw all accounting, financial controls and investor reporting for Sitex’s portfolio of real estate investments. Michis also served on the firm’s executive team, providing detailed oversight of all company financial and accounting information, tax reporting and investor correspondence.

Prior to joining Sitex, Michis was an Accountant with McShane Development Company and a Senior Accountant at ML Realty Partners where she reported to the Vice President/Controller in support of an $800 million industrial real estate portfolio with 87 active subsidiaries. 

Michis is a graduate of DePaul University in Chicago.

Tombers will lead Timber Hills’ acquisition activities across the U.S. He was most recently the Head of Acquisitions at Los Angeles-based Iconic Equities and prior to that he was the Managing Director — Western U.S. at CrowdStreet. During his decade plus career he has completed transactions valued at more than $1 billion. 

Tombers earned a BS from the University of Illinois at Chicago. He also holds FINRA securities professional licenses SIE, 63, and 79.
